    Abstract: A ridge flow based fingerprint image quality determination can be achieved independent of image resolution, can be processed in real-time and includes segmentation, such as fingertip segmentation, therefore providing image quality assessment for individual fingertips within a four finger flat, dual thumb, or whole hand image. A fingerprint quality module receives from one or more scan devices ridge-flow—containing imagery which can then be assessed for one or more of quality, handedness, historical information analysis and the assignment of bounding boxes.

    Abstract: A separator comprising a vessel, a tray assembly positioned within the vessel, and a wall structure arranged to accumulate a first liquid and a second liquid. A first automatic drain valve is operable to automatically allow liquid accumulated above a first liquid outlet to pass from the vessel in such a way as to maintain a volume of the first liquid above the first automatic drain valve to create a liquid seal over the first automatic drain valve, and a second automatic drain valve is operable to automatically allow liquid accumulated above the level of an open upper end of the wall structure to pass from the vessel in such a way as to maintain a volume of the second liquid above the second automatic drain valve to create a liquid seal over the second automatic drain valve.

    Abstract: Systems and methods for repairing cross-linked biometric records receive a set of biometric records. Each biometric record contains at least one biometric sample in a non-textual modality. One or more of the biometric records in the set of biometric records is potentially a cross-linked biometric record having at least two biometric samples that are associated with different individuals. Crosslink resolution is performed on the set of biometric records by searching for a match between a biometric sample in a given non-textual modality of a given biometric record with each biometric sample of the same given non-textual modality in each of the other biometric records in the set of biometric records. During the crosslink resolution, biometric sample may be removed from one biometric record and merged with another biometric record.

    Abstract: Methods for treating a patient and further to devices for performing such treatment, e.g., methods and devices to perturb at least one physiological system and deliver therapy to the patient based on the effects of such perturbation. For example, a method for using an implantable medical device is disclosed that involves delivering electrical stimuli to an efferent nerve associated with the selected organ. Afferent electrical activity is monitored during delivery of electrical stimuli to the efferent nerve, the monitored afferent electrical activity includes an indirect component of a compound action potential (CAP). A status of the selected organ is assessed based upon the indirect component. A determination is made as to whether to deliver therapy to the selected organ in response to assessing the status of the selected organ.

    Abstract: Tools and methods for preparing an intervertebral disc space with an emphasis on abrading the vertebral endplates to promote controlled bleeding of the vertebral endplate without compromising the structural integrity of the vertebral endplate. The abrading process may be used to remove cartilage from the vertebral endplate if this remains to be done. Various mechanisms are discussed to either statically or dynamically alter blade angle of the cutter blade. Cutter blades may come in a variety of configurations including cutter blades with abrading heads for preparing endplates. Abrading heads may be used on upcutters or down cutters. Also disclosed is a cutter assembly adapted to resist unwanted changes in blade angle.

    Abstract: An apparatus for loading a bone graft material includes a preloading assembly, and a dispenser assembly. A method of dispensing bone graft material includes loading bone graft material into the preloader, compacting the material and transferring the compacted bone graft material into the cannula. The compacted bone graft material is vented to release unwanted or undesirable air, vapor or other gases from the bone graft material. The bone graft material is dispensed after the cannula is placed in a desired or selected position with respect to an intervertebral space.
